Construction work on Chestnut Street Bridge/I-76 viaducts to resume Monday, May 4

May 1, 2020

Construction work on the Chestnut Street Bridge and Schuylkill Expressway/I-76 viaducts will resume on Monday, May 4, according to an announcement by PennDOT. Motorists should watch out for reduced lanes and closed shoulders and ramps in the work area. Expect significant backups and delays near the work area.

PennDOT is resuming the project in accordance with Governor Tom Wolf’s plan for a phased-in reopening of public and private construction. The project was paused on March 17 in response to mitigation efforts. Work on the project will be in compliance with Centers for Disease Control and state Department of Health guidance as well as a project-specific COVID-19 safety plan, which includes protocols for social distancing, use of face coverings, personal and job-site cleaning protocols, and other safety measures. 

The construction work is part of the Chestnut Street Bridges Project, which is now expected to be completed by the end of this year. The Chestnut Street Bridge has been closed to motorists since last summer.
